Subject: Hardware lab access for your teams

Hi all,

From Monday, the Tannerly hardware lab on Level 2 moves to badge-plus-code entry. Team assistants should make sure anyone booked into the lab has completed the safety briefing with Priya on the Opswell team first. Visitors must be escorted at all times. Please share the following entry code only with briefed staff; it rotates monthly.

staff pass of haduf-yagaf = bdg-DBSQF-1

- [ ] Verify feature parity between the Lumaris SDK for Kotlin and the Swift client before tagging the release. Plugin authors rely on identical hook signatures, pagination behavior, and error codes across both. Run the cross-SDK conformance suite and confirm no skipped cases. If any method diverges, file a parity ticket and block the tag. The conformance build that passed is referenced by the token below.

pipeline stamp: htk9_ce63042d9

## Capacity Note: Furrowlink Telemetry Gateway

On-call: harvest season doubles message volume from Furrowlink field units, mostly between 0500 and 0900 local. The gateway buffers to disk when the upstream broker lags; disk fills fast if the broker is down more than twenty minutes at peak. Do not raise ingest concurrency without also raising the flush worker count, or you'll trade broker lag for compaction stalls. Alerts fire on buffer depth, not age, so watch both. Shed load via the sampling knob first. Current constants follow.

constants for bawif-kawif:
QUOTAS = {
    "ulaael": 5,
    "holael": 10,
}

**On-call onboarding: Fetchline circuit breaker.** The Fetchline service wraps the upstream Tidegate API with a circuit breaker that trips after five consecutive 5xx responses within thirty seconds. When tripped, requests fail fast for two minutes before a half-open probe. If the breaker sticks open after an upstream recovery, you must force-reset it from the admin console, which requires the recovery passphrase below.

vault phrase of bagaf-kajeg = jorath-feniel-briir-siliel-ralix